mirror of
https://github.com/nuxt/nuxt.git
synced 2024-11-11 08:33:53 +00:00
Update transpile to return the opposite of exclude
This commit is contained in:
parent
13ae634c74
commit
f275fc8069
@ -21,7 +21,7 @@ describe('basic dev', () => {
|
|||||||
extend({ module: { rules } }, { isClient }) {
|
extend({ module: { rules } }, { isClient }) {
|
||||||
if (isClient) {
|
if (isClient) {
|
||||||
const babelLoader = rules.find(loader => loader.test.test('.jsx'))
|
const babelLoader = rules.find(loader => loader.test.test('.jsx'))
|
||||||
transpile = babelLoader.exclude
|
transpile = (file) => !babelLoader.exclude(file)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
@ -34,10 +34,10 @@ describe('basic dev', () => {
|
|||||||
|
|
||||||
test('Config: build.transpile', async () => {
|
test('Config: build.transpile', async () => {
|
||||||
expect(transpile('vue-test')).toBeUndefined()
|
expect(transpile('vue-test')).toBeUndefined()
|
||||||
expect(transpile('node_modules/test.js')).toBe(true)
|
expect(transpile('node_modules/test.js')).toBe(false)
|
||||||
expect(transpile('node_modules/vue-test')).toBe(false)
|
expect(transpile('node_modules/vue-test')).toBe(true)
|
||||||
expect(transpile('node_modules/vue.test.js')).toBe(false)
|
expect(transpile('node_modules/vue.test.js')).toBe(true)
|
||||||
expect(transpile('node_modules/test.vue.js')).toBe(false)
|
expect(transpile('node_modules/test.vue.js')).toBe(true)
|
||||||
})
|
})
|
||||||
|
|
||||||
test('/stateless', async () => {
|
test('/stateless', async () => {
|
||||||
|
Loading…
Reference in New Issue
Block a user